55-Year-Old Clears Matric Exam

Faiz-ul-Haq, a 55-year-old resident of Pishin, has successfully passed his matriculation exams, proving that learning has no age limit. He scored 600 marks and secured a second division.

Employed as a peon at the Government Boys High School, Nawaabad, Faiz-ul-Haq had long aspired to study but was unable to pursue his education earlier due to financial responsibilities and the need to support his family.

Encouraged by the teachers and staff at his school, he decided to finally chase his dream. With their support and motivation, he managed to complete his matriculation — a goal he had postponed for decades.

In recognition of his efforts and achievements, the school staff and teachers honored him by adorning him with garlands in a small celebratory gesture.
